Obituary – Edna G Slater (1928-2022)

Edna G. Slater of Waldron, Arkansas went to be with her Lord and Savior, Wednesday, June 22, 2022 in Waldron, Arkansas with her loving family by her side. Edna was born June 10, 1928 in Staph Oklahoma to William L. Yandell and Mary E. (Wagner) Yandell. She was 94 years young.

Edna was a vivacious woman. She loved laughing and having a good time. She enjoyed being surrounded by her family and friends making sweet memories. Edna loved to read, garden, work in her flower beds and do yard work. She could also be found watching old westerns, episodes of Andy Griffith or doing word search puzzles to keep her sharp.  

Edna leaves behind to cherish her memory, her children: Bobby Slater and wife Kathy, Ellen Hayden and husband Ernie, Robbie Nelson and husband Gary all of Waldron, Arkansas, Sandy (Slater) Brogdon, Patti (Slater) Jenson, Gail (Slater) Yeoman, and Barbie VanMatre and husband Danny. Grandma will forever remain in the hearts of her grandchildren: Sharla Pennington, Alisha Jimenez, Keith Slater, Billy Ray Zimmer, Sheila Nix, Marcus Zimmer, Brian Zimmer, Pam Archer, Tammy Diaz, Russell Hayden and Samuel Slater as well as a bunch of great grandchildren, great great grandchildren. Edna will be missed by all that knew her and the many whose lives she impacted including a host of extended family and friends she loved dearly.

Edna was preceded in death by her parents William and Mary Yandell, the father of her children, Raymond C. Slater, her 2nd husband, Willard Slater and one son, Ralph “Bimbo” Slater, great grandsons Adam Boggs, and Christopher Zimmer and grandson in law Mark Nix, and siblings: Roy Yandell, Alan Yandell, Onis Yandell and Evelyn Hunt.

A private family celebration of life will be held at a later date. Arrangements and cremation are being entrusted to the Heritage Memorial Funeral Home & Crematory in Waldron, Arkansas.
